Allogeneic T cell expansion is the primary determinant of graft-versus-host disease (GVHD). The current understanding is that this expansion is driven by histocompatibility antigen disparities between donor and recipient. This paradigm represents a closed genetic system where donor T cells interact with peptide-major histocompatibility complexes (MHCs).
